This volume is summing up three years (2023, 2024, 2025) of the 'Mihai Eminescu Poetry Festivals' in Australia - in which Australian Poets, as well as some Romanians ones, respond to curated themes from the work of the best known Romanian poet.For each festival some 10-15 poets are invited participate and respond - and their work, alongside the Eminescu poems providing the points of inspiration - are represented bilingually in English and Romanian, in this volume.The English translations of the Mihai Eminescu poems have been selected from the volume 'Romanian Poetry from its Origins to the Present: A bilingual Anthology - Daniel Ionita, Daniel Reynaud, Adriana Paul & Eva Foster - Australian-Romanian Academy for Culture, Sydney 2020)The three thems for the three years respectively have been1.The Universal Within The Local (2023) - or how Eminescu’s local artistic roots travel into the universal space, filtered and reimagined by contemprary poets. The Eminescu poems chosen for this have been Sonnet - Gone are the Years, Ode (in an Antique Meter), Why Won’t you Come.2 - The Loneliness of the Long Distance Poet (2024)- exploring the singular loneliness of the artist in an hyper-connected but paradoxically fragmented world. The Eminescu poem chosen as the inspiration anchor has been The Evening Star (Luceafărul).3 - Poetry of Resilience (2025) - exploring how could the poet, and poetry provide resilience in an increasingly belligerant and fraught world. The Eminescu poem for this was Glossa.
